German Protection Minister Christine Lambrecht on Monday tendered her resignation, amid scrutiny above Berlin’s response to the war in Ukraine.

“Nowadays I asked the Chancellor to be released from the purpose of defence minister,” Lambrecht claimed in a statement, in accordance to a CNBC translation.

Her stepdown arrives as Germany mulls no matter whether to approve an increase in military services assistance to Ukraine in buy to aid Kyiv’s armed forces prevail from the Russian onslaught.

“The aim from the media more than months on my man or woman rarely lets for objective reporting and dialogue about the troopers, the armed forces and the system for security policy in the desire of Germany’s citizens,” Lambrecht explained.

“The important function of the troopers and the numerous determined men and women in the market wants to be at the forefront. I hence decided to make my post obtainable,” she additional. “I thank everyone who engages them selves for our protection just about every working day and sincerely would like them the ideal of luck for the long term.”

Lambrecht, a senior lawmaker in German Chancellor Olaf Scholz’s Social Democratic Celebration, had confronted sustained force in excess of her credibility to direct the country’s armed forces.

Multiple media outlets noted around the weekend that Lambrecht’s resignation could be imminent, adhering to a series of missteps.
